GET THE MOST ACCURATE READINGS POSSIBLE
STEP 3: MOUNTING BASICS
At this time, all of your sensor information should be displayed on your station.
Note: For detailed mounting instructions, please review the full manual.
Here are a few quick tips for mounting your sensors:
Keep out of direct sunlight & ensure the sensor is well-ventilated.
Be sure to mount your sensor vertically to all moisture to drain out properly.
We recommend mounting under a deck or eave facing north.

WIFI NETWORK REQUIREMENTS
· Broadcast Frequency: 2.4GHz (802.11 b/g/n)
· Network Name/Password: Must Not Exceed 45 Characters
· Network Speed: Must Be Greater than 1 Mbps
Note: If you have a multiple band router, be sure your mobile device is connected to the 2.4 GHz frequency when setting up the app.
iOS REQUIREMENTS
· iOS 9.0 or higher with cellular or Wi-Fi service
ANDROID REQUIREMENTS
· Android OS 5.0 or higher with cellular or Wi-Fi service
STATION & SENSOR SPECS
STATION DISPLAY (C84343)
· Indoor Temperature Range: 32°F to 122°F (0°C to 50°C)
· Indoor Humidity Range: 10% to 99%RH
· Power Requirements: 5.0V AC Adapter
+ 3 “AA” Batteries (sold separately)
THERMOHYGRO (LTV-TH2)
· Outdoor Temperature Range: -40°F to 140°F (-40°C to 60°C)
· Outdoor Humidity Range: 10% to 99%RH
· Power Requirements: 2 “AA” Batteries (sold separately)
· Sensor Transmission Range: 400 Feet (121.92 Meters)
